fre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

第二章關系數(shù)據(jù)庫-閱讀頁

2024-08-20 13:01本頁面
  

【正文】 = )) ?69 ( 11)集函數(shù) 關系演算語言中提供了以下常用集函數(shù)(內(nèi) 部函數(shù)): 函 數(shù) 名 功 能 COUNT 對元組計數(shù) TOTAL 求 總 和 MAX 求最大值 MIN 求最小值 AVG 求平均值 70 集函數(shù) (續(xù) ) [例 15] 查詢學生所在系的數(shù)目 。 [例 16] 查詢信息系學生的平均年齡 GET W (AVG(): =39。 HOLD W (, ): =39。 MOVE 39。 TO UPDATE W 74 ( 2)插入操作 插入操作用 PUT 語句實現(xiàn) , 步驟如下: ?用 宿主語言 在 工作空間 中 建立新元組 ?用 PUT 語句把該元組存入指定關系中 75 插入操作 (續(xù) ) [例 18] 學校新開設了一門 2 學分的課程 ? 計算機組織與結(jié)構(gòu) ? , 其課程號為 8, 直接先行課為 6 號課程 。839。計算機組織與結(jié)構(gòu) 39。639。239。 HOLD W (Student): =39。 DELETE W 78 刪除操作 (續(xù) ) [例 20] 將學號 95001 改為 95102。9500139。9510239。李勇 39。男 39。2039。CS39。 HOLD W ( Student ) DELETE W HOLD W ( SC ) DELETE W 在刪除操作中保持參照完整性 80 小結(jié):元組關系演算語言 ALPHA ? 檢索操作 GET GET 工作空間名 [( 定額 ) ]( 表達式 1) [: 操作條件 ] [DOWN/UP 表達式 2] ? 插入操作 建立新元組 PUT ? 修改操作 HOLD修改 UPDATE ? 刪除操作 HOLDDELETE 81 關 系 演 算 ? 元組關系演算語言 ALPHA ? 域關系演算語言 QBE 82 域關系演算語言 QBE l 一種典型的 域關系演算 語言 ? 由 ? 1978年在 IBM370上得以實現(xiàn) ? QBE也指 此 關系數(shù)據(jù)庫管理系統(tǒng) l QBE: Query By Example ?基于屏幕表格的查詢語言 ?查詢要求:以填寫表格的方式構(gòu)造查詢 ?用示例元素 (域變量 )來表示查詢結(jié)果可能的情況 ?查詢結(jié)果:以表格形式顯示 83 QBE操作框架 關系名 屬性名 操作命令 元組屬性值或查詢條件或操作命令 84 一、檢索操作 ( 1) 用戶提出要求; ( 2) 屏幕顯示空白表格: Student ( 3)用戶在最左邊一欄輸入要查詢的關系名,例如 Student: 85 檢索操作(續(xù)) ( 4)系統(tǒng)顯示該關系的屬性名 Student Sno Sname Ssex Sage Sdept P. T AO. IS Student Sno Sname Ssex Sage Sdept ( 5)用戶在上面構(gòu)造查詢要求 86 檢索操作(續(xù)) ( 6)屏幕顯示查詢結(jié)果 Student Sno Sname Ssex Sage Sdept 李勇 張立 C 87 構(gòu)造查詢的幾個要素 ? T:示例元素 即域變量 一定要加下劃線 示例元素是這個域中可能的一個值 , 它不必是查詢結(jié)果中的元素 ? 打印操作符 P. : 指定查詢結(jié)果所含屬性列 ? 查詢條件 不用加下劃線 可使用比較運算符>, ≥,<, ≤,=和 ≠ 其中=可以省略 ? 排序要求 : AO.:升序, DO.:降序 88 1. 簡單查詢 [例 1] 查詢?nèi)w學生的全部數(shù)據(jù) 。 Student Sno Sname Ssex Sage Sdept P. 李勇 IS [例 3] 求年齡大于 19歲的學生的學號 。 Student Sno Sname Ssex Sage Sdept 19 CS 方法 ( 1) :把兩個條件寫在 同一行 上 方法 ( 2) :把兩個條件寫在 不同行 上 , 但使用 相同的示例元素值 Student Sno Sname Ssex Sage Sdept 19 CS 91 2. 條件查詢( 一個屬性中的與關系 ) [例 5] 查詢既選修了 1號課程又選修了 2號課程的學生的學號 。 92 2. 條件查詢( 或 關系) [例 6] 查詢 計算機科學系 或者 年齡大于 19歲的學生的學號 。 93 多表連接 [例 7] 查詢選修 1號課程的學生姓名 。 94 條件查詢(非條件) [例 8] 查詢未選修 1號課程的學生姓名 SC Sno Cno Grade 95001 1 ? Student Sno Sname Ssex Sage Sdept 95001 思路:顯示學號為 95001 的學生名字 , 而該學生選修 1號課程的情況為假 ( 用邏輯非 ? 表示 ) 95 條件查詢(續(xù)) [例 9] 查詢有兩個人以上選修的課程號 SC Sno Cno Grade 95001 ? 95001 1 思路:查詢這樣的課程 1,它不僅被 95001選修,而且也被另一個學生( ? 95001)選修 96 3. 集函數(shù) QBE語言提供的常用集函數(shù): 函 數(shù) 名 功 能 CNT 對元組計數(shù) SUM 求 總 和 AVG 求平均值 MAX 求最大值 MIN 求最小值 97 集函數(shù)(續(xù)) [例 10] 查詢信息系學生的平均年齡 。 Student Sno Sname Ssex Sage Sdept 男 DO( 2) . AO( 1) . 99 二、修改操作 [例 12] 把 95001學生的年齡改為 18歲 。 ? U.”標明所在的行是 修改后的新值 。 101 修改操作 (續(xù) ) [例 13]將計算機系所有學生的年齡都改為 18歲 Student Sno Sname Ssex Sage Sdept 95008 CS 102 修改操作 (續(xù) ) [例 14] 把 95001學生的年齡增加 1歲 Student Sno Sname Ssex Sage Sdept U. 95001 95001 17 17+1 分 兩行 分別表示改前和改后的示例元素 必須將操作符? U.”放在關系上 103 修改操作 (續(xù) ) [例 15] 將計算機系所有學生的年齡都增加 1歲 Student Sno Sname Ssex Sage Sdept U. 95008 95008 18 18+1 CS 104 [例 16] 把信息系女生 95701, 姓名張三 , 年齡17歲存入數(shù)據(jù)庫
點擊復制文檔內(nèi)容
研究報告相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1